I needed something fast that I could throw together with ingredients out of my bare cupboards! I found a can of chicken, a roll of crescent rolls, shredded cheese, sour cream and Italian seasoning. I preheated the oven based on temp on crescent roll can. Then I mixed the chicken, the cheese. sour cream and Italian seasoning together. Then I unrolled the crescent rolls laid each one flat on the cookie sheet, placed a spoonful of the chicken mixture on each piece of dough and wrapped the dough around the chicken. When they were all wrapped up I baked them for about 10 minutes or until they were golden brown. They were really good and I figured them up to be about 150 calories a piece. The made the perfect throw together lunch and reheated well the next day too!
Ingredients
1 pkg crescent rolls
1 can chicken
1/4 cup shredded cheese
1 Tbsp Italian seasoning
1 Tbsp sour cream
